Phở Hòa is a popular spot, especially for those at Fort Bliss or shopping at the PX. Customers rave about the flavorful pho, vermicelli bowls, and boba drinks. The service is frequently praised, with staff being friendly and helpful.

I love pho and this place makes it. I love the Thai tea. I ordered the vegetable pho and was surprised by the large quantity of delicious vegetables. It was enough for two meals. The fried rolls were small but very tasty! It’s easy to customize with extra noodles and the pho comes with the sauces.
Choose the DINE IN for the pho. You get a nice, large bowl (and lids are available on the side). The to-go cup separated the soup for you and appears to be well constructed to prevent leakage, but you won't be able to fit all of the items into the broth immediately (a watched a friend try to fit all the rice noodles in there). The beef pho is my favorite option so far. The chicken is a little bland itself- but is an okay with the broth. The chicken banh-mi is a great sandwich (not the same taste as the chicken in the pho). I personally liked it better than other banh-mi sandwiches I have had elsewhere (namely Oregon). The teas are great! The come sealed and have chunks of fruit in them (I enjoyed the green tea and the Vietnamese coffee). One of my soldiers loved the taro smoothie. I would absolutely recommend stopping by here. Even in the summer heat of July, the pho is worth it (maybe because the AC of Freedom Crossing) - don't overlook this option!
